<p>Toshi&#8217;s bar is only 6 deep, 3 on each side of a 40 degrees angle. The entire house can&#8217;t seat more than 30 people and there&#8217;s only 1 waiter, 1 itame (the chef/owner himself) and 1 hostess with perhaps 1 more person in the kitchen. It&#8217;s a simplistic operation occupying 1 small storefront between Daikokuya and the Japanese American Museum. </p>
<p>Above all became moot when I saw the menu: $35 for omakase with 12 pieces of fish! Sign my ass up!!!</p>
<p>Much like the other famous Seki-san in the LA Sushi Scene (Keizo Seki of Sushi Zo), Toshi Sushi&#8217;s Toshihiko Seki believes in the &#8220;old school&#8221;, which, in this case, means Edo style from &#8220;30-40 years ago&#8221;. For him, this means no sugar in the sushi rice, less vinegar and more salt in the tighter compact nigiri and more natural cuts of fish that don&#8217;t look like perfect rectangles. He even wraps certain fishes in kelp since Saran wasn&#8217;t readily available in Japan back then. This all suits me perfectly. </p>
<p>End result: sunomono consisting of miso-vinegar paste mixed with yamaimo and various root veggies + tuna, etc. 3 small kaiseki-style appetizer served together including roes, octupus, etc. A huge bowl of manila clams miso soup was followed by a miso black cod (needs more miso and obviously, not made by itame) &#038; 10 piece set which included toro, shima aji, Japanese red snapper, albacore, torch seared kobe!?! etc. (I did ask for more shiromi, but nothing as exotic as engawa, or sanma/aji were served, NEXT time). Topping off the omakase were a few pieces of mochi ice cream and some fruit.</p>
<p>Easily the best bargain in all of Little Tokyo at the moment. Toshi-san is amiable, convivial but respectful of those seeking the higher path in sushi dining. </p>
